The author studies the rate of almost everywhere approximation to square integrable functions by the rectangular partial sums of their orthogonal expansion \[ \sum_{j=0}^\infty \sum_{k=0}^\infty a_{jk}\phi_{jk}(x), \] where \(\{\phi_{jk}(x)\}\) is a double orthonormal system on a positive measure space. He obtains best possible rates of approximation under appropriate conditions imposed on the decrease of the coefficients \(\{a_{jk}\}\), provided the class \(\Phi\) of all double orthogonal systems is taken into consideration. He also shows in examples that the conditions imposed on \(\{a_{jk}\}\) are necessary in order to guarantee the rate in question on the whole class \(\Phi\). These results generalize and extend recent theorems achieved by K. Tandori, V.I. Koljada, H. Schwinn, and the reviewer.
